I don't disagree, and I'd love a free open-source video codec that compared favorably with H.264. I wouldn't be surprised if we have one soon. But we don't yet.

I would be surprised, actually. With vague software patents covering nearly everything related to video encoding ("Method for the computation of the sum of two integers"), it's a legal minefield. If people could freely implement their own ideas, then we would definitely have something better. But thanks to software patents, this is not possible.

